Photovoltaic glass is a type of glass that integrates solar technology to generate electricity while maintaining its functionality as a window. Here are some key points:Transparent Photovoltaic Smart Glass converts ultraviolet and infrared light into electricity while allowing visible light to enter buildings, enhancing energy efficiency1.There is a growing demand for solar photovoltaic glass, which includes various types like ultra-thin and low-iron glass used in solar cells2.By incorporating transparent solar cells between glass layers, photovoltaic glass enables buildings to generate clean electricity3.Photovoltaic windows combine traditional window functions with solar panel technology, using special coatings or thin-film cells embedded within the glass4. Rare earth materials are so called not because they are rare in the earth’s crust, but because they are chemically very similar. This makes them difficult to mine and separate without. .
Unlike the wind power and EV sectors, the solar PV industry isn’t reliant on rare earth materials. Instead, solar cells use a range of minor metals including silicon, indium, gallium, selenium,. .
Solar technology developers are exploring the use of new materials for PV cells as the industry looks to increase cell efficiencies, reduce. Instead, solar cells use a range of minor metals including silicon, indium, gallium, selenium, cadmium, and tellurium. Minor metals, which are sometimes referred to as rare metals, are by-products from the refining of base metals such as copper, nickel, and zinc. [pdf]

An off-grid solar system, also known as off-the-grid or standalone, is a photovoltaic system that has no access to the utility grid. For this reason, off-grid solar systems involve both solar panels and battery storage, so the power can be coming to the building from either of these two. .
